Review of Fortress

Fortress (1992)
6/10
Decent low budget sci fi/action from director Stuart Gordon
8 August 2019
After a screening of Re Animator, Arnold Scharzenegger was eager to work with the director of Re Animator, Stuart Gordon and was originally supposed to play the lead in this. Fortress was going to be a big movie with a budget around 70 million, but once Arnold dropped out of the project and Christopher Lambert was cast the budget dropped to around 15 million. Still Fortress made a lot of money at the box office and is an action packed low budget sci fi prison movie that would be best described as a lower budgeted cross between Escape Plan and Total Recall. Christopher Lambert did a good enough job as the lead, but the best performance comes from Kurtwood Smith, best known for Robocop and 3rd Rock From The Sun as prison warden. Horror icons Tom Toyles and Jeffrey Combs appear as well as Vernon Wells(best known as Bennett from Commando). The film overall comes across dated, but is still decent entertainment and good for the genre with a lot of action.
